Who needs prehospital protocols - dmemsmd?

01
Prehospital healthcare providers, such as emergency medical technicians (EMTs) or paramedics, need prehospital protocols - dmemsmd to guide their clinical decision-making and actions in emergency situations. These protocols help ensure that patients receive standardized, evidence-based care in the prehospital setting.
02
Dispatchers or communication center personnel also benefit from prehospital protocols - dmemsmd as they assist in determining the appropriate level of response, resource allocation, and initial instructions provided to callers reporting emergencies. These protocols help ensure a consistent and efficient emergency response system.
03
Medical directors and quality improvement committees utilize prehospital protocols - dmemsmd to develop, review, and update the guidelines for prehospital care within their jurisdictions. These protocols serve as a framework for ensuring high-quality, safe, and consistent emergency medical services across the system.
